In the past few days, several incidents of theft and vandalism have been reported in the town of Bad Hersfeld and its surrounding areas.

On Tuesday evening, around 10 p.m., a 17-year-old resident of Bad Hersfeld had a package stolen from him at a pick-up station at a shopping market in the Erfurter Straße in the "Hohe Luft" district. The unknown individual who committed the theft can be described as a male, approximately 20 years old, glasses, sturdy build, blonde hair with a part, white shirt, black pants, and a yellow safety vest. He fled in the direction of Petersberg after the incident. The value of the stolen package is around 180 euros.

On the same day, between Monday, September 1, around 3 p.m., and Tuesday, September 2, around 2 p.m., unknown individuals stole a black Evercross EV85F e-scooter from a basement room of a multi-family house in Jenaer Straße, Bad Hersfeld. Despite extensive searches, no details about the e-scooter or the location of the theft have been made available. The value of the stolen e-scooter is currently unknown.

Between Friday, August 29, and Tuesday, September 2, unknown individuals scratched a silver Mercedes Sprinter parked in the Dreherstraße in the "Hohe Luft" district of Bad Hersfeld using an unknown object. The amount of damage to the vehicle is currently unknown.

In a separate incident, unknown individuals stole the official license plates "HEF-DK 85" from a gray Mazda 2 parked in the extension of Wittichweg in the Blankenheim district, Bebra, overnight on Tuesday.
